If you own an Apple device (Mac, iPad, or iPhone), Hiragino Sans TC is . Apple licenses this font family directly from SCREEN, allowing Apple users to utilize it for creating graphics, documents, and designs within the macOS/iOS environment. 2. If you subscribe to Adobe Creative Cloud (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ign), you have access to (formerly Typekit). While not strictly "free," it is included in your existing subscription cost. Adobe partners with type foundries to provide a vast library of high-quality East Asian fonts that can be activated with a single click for commercial use.
